I know many Poles and I've visited Warsaw many times. Before WW2 it was apparently a beautiful city then it was destroyed in those 6 years, especially so in the Uprising of 1944. They then had 40 years of Communism, when it became a concrete jungle. Not the Poles' fault. It has improved drastically with 28-29 years of democracy & freedom but I agree that there's still a long way to go.
The City I have no problem with at all and I always enjoy my visits there as I love the people and atmosphere. My issues are with that stadium, which though an excellent sports stadium, has about the worst concert accoustics ever according to just about every Pole I know or have spoken to who's ever seen a concert there. If it was at any other venue in the country I'd definitely go. The 1998 show in Chorzow, 200 miles further South was one of the best Stones gigs I've ever been to. Loads of footage of it on Youtube as it was professionally filmed and broadcast 2 weeks later.
